Factors to Consider When Choosing Lures for Summer Bass Fishing

When choosing lures for summer bass fishing, consider factors like water temperature, which can affect bass behavior and lure effectiveness. You'll want to select lure colors that match the environment and the targeted bass species, ensuring you attract the right catch. Also, think about how your lure adapts to different fishing techniques and how it performs around various cover and structures.

Water Temperature Impact

As summer heats up and water temperatures climb above 75°F, understanding how these changes affect bass behavior is essential for successful fishing. Bass activity levels increase with higher metabolism, making them more aggressive. They often retreat to cooler, deeper waters during the heat of the day. To entice them, use lures that mimic prey in these areas. Additionally, bass are likely to congregate near structures like weeds, rocks, and submerged logs, so weedless lures are beneficial to navigate these environments. Water clarity shifts with temperature, impacting visibility, so choosing lures with bright or contrasting colors can help catch their eye. Finally, speed up your retrieval, as bass are more prone to striking faster-moving lures in warmer conditions.

Lure Color Selection

While fishing for bass in the summer, choosing the right lure color can greatly boost your chances of success. Bright colors like chartreuse and orange stand out in clear water, drawing bass in with their visibility. In murky or stained water, opt for darker hues such as black or blue. These colors create a strong silhouette, making them more visible and appealing to bass. Natural shades like greens and browns mimic local forage, especially when bass are feeding on baitfish. Consider the time of day too; lighter colors work well on sunny days, while darker ones shine during cloudy or low-light conditions. Don't hesitate to experiment with different colors throughout the day, as bass behavior can shift with changing light and water clarity.

Targeted Bass Species

Summer bass fishing requires a strategic approach to lure selection based on the specific species you're targeting. Largemouth bass are more active in warmer waters, often hiding in vegetation or shaded spots. When aiming for them, choose lures that mimic local prey and can navigate through cover effectively. Smallmouth bass seek cooler, oxygen-rich waters, so focus on deeper or faster-moving areas. Use lures that can dive deep or withstand currents. Spotted bass thrive near rocky structures or underwater ledges. Opt for lures that imitate the local baitfish around these spots. Bass feeding behavior shifts in summer, becoming more aggressive during low-light conditions like early mornings or late evenings. Match your lure to the specific forage in the water body for better results.

Fishing Technique Adaptability

When choosing lures for summer bass fishing, their adaptability to different retrieval techniques can greatly boost your success. Consider lures that work well with both slow and fast retrieves, as these can enhance catch rates in warmer waters. Opt for weedless designs, like those with soft plastic bodies, to navigate heavy cover and vegetation commonly found in summer. The lure's action is crucial; realistic swimming motion and noise attraction mimic baitfish behavior, enticing active bass. Multi-jointed lures that sink slowly and have a natural appearance are effective for targeting bass at varying depths. Additionally, lures with built-in rattles can trigger feeding instincts in bass, making them particularly useful during the aggressive summer months when fish are most active.

Cover and Structure Considerations

Choosing the right lure is only half the battle; understanding the environment where you're fishing is equally important. In the summer, bass often retreat to shaded, cooler waters, making areas like lily pads, submerged logs, and overhanging trees prime targets. Structures such as rocky points, drop-offs, and ledges also serve as excellent ambush spots since they attract baitfish. Weeds and grass beds provide both shelter and feeding grounds for bass, allowing them to hunt effectively. During peak sunlight, bass tend to hide near these structures due to temperature and light conditions. To increase your chances of success, use lures that mimic natural prey and can effectively navigate these varied environments, enticing bites from bass lurking in cover and structure.

Lure Action and Movement

Understanding lure action and movement is essential in summer bass fishing because these elements mimic the natural movements of baitfish and trigger the predatory instincts of bass. Effective lures, like jointed swimbaits with S-wave action, create realistic swimming motions that attract larger fish. The design features, such as a paddle tail or ribbed body, generate vibrations and turbulence in the water, making them irresistible to bass, especially when they're more active in warmer temperatures. Slow sinking lures are versatile, allowing you to target different water layers where bass hide during summer. Your choice of color and action is vital; vibrant or natural hues can enhance success depending on water clarity and conditions. Adapt your lure's action to maximize your catch.
